Standalone Data Visualization Tools Market size was valued at USD 5.5 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 12.0 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 10.5% from 2024 to 2030.
The Standalone Data Visualization Tools Market has seen significant growth in recent years, largely driven by the increasing need for businesses and organizations to make data-driven decisions. These tools offer a way to present data in a more understandable and actionable form, with visual formats such as graphs, charts, and dashboards. The market is categorized by application, which includes a variety of industries and use cases. The key sectors benefiting from data visualization tools include finance, healthcare, retail, manufacturing, and others. The ability to easily interpret large sets of complex data has made these tools essential in the decision-making processes of organizations of all sizes. As more industries adopt data-driven approaches, the demand for standalone data visualization tools continues to rise, further expanding the market's potential.

Large enterprises are one of the dominant segments in the standalone data visualization tools market. These organizations typically manage vast amounts of data across multiple departments and geographies, making it difficult to derive meaningful insights without powerful visualization tools. Standalone data visualization tools allow large enterprises to centralize their data analysis efforts and offer real-time, actionable insights in an easily understandable format. By leveraging these tools, large enterprises can enhance strategic decision-making, streamline operations, and improve performance across various business units. Additionally, the growing emphasis on business intelligence (BI) and analytics within large enterprises drives the need for more advanced, scalable, and secure visualization solutions.The use of standalone data visualization tools also supports large enterprises in transforming complex data into compelling visual narratives, which can be shared with stakeholders to influence decisions and strategies. As these organizations increasingly integrate data visualization into their workflows, they recognize its potential for improving operational efficiency, customer experience, and overall business intelligence capabilities. Furthermore, large enterprises often have the financial resources to invest in sophisticated tools and analytics platforms, ensuring they stay ahead in an increasingly data-driven world. The increasing adoption of big data, artificial intelligence, and machine learning technologies further enhances the demand for visualization tools that can handle these complex datasets.
SMEs are increasingly adopting standalone data visualization tools to enhance their business intelligence and analytics capabilities, despite having fewer resources than large enterprises. These organizations recognize the importance of leveraging data to drive growth, improve operational efficiency, and stay competitive in their respective markets. The relatively lower cost and user-friendly interface of standalone data visualization tools make them an appealing choice for SMEs, offering powerful analytics without the need for extensive technical expertise. For SMEs, the ability to visualize data in real-time enables more agile decision-making and provides a clear view of key business metrics, which is critical for survival and growth in a competitive landscape.Moreover, standalone data visualization tools provide SMEs with the flexibility to integrate data from various sources, such as sales, customer feedback, and financials, into comprehensive dashboards. This makes it easier for business owners and managers to identify trends, track performance, and make informed decisions without relying on large, dedicated teams or advanced infrastructure. As the market continues to evolve, SMEs are increasingly seeking cost-effective solutions that can scale as their business grows. The availability of cloud-based, subscription-based models further accelerates the adoption of data visualization tools among smaller organizations, making these solutions accessible to businesses with limited IT budgets.
Several key trends are shaping the future of the standalone data visualization tools market. First, there is an increasing focus on user-friendly, intuitive interfaces that allow non-technical users to generate powerful insights without a steep learning curve. As organizations look to democratize data access, tools that cater to users without specialized technical skills are in high demand. This trend is especially prevalent in SMEs and mid-market organizations, which need simple yet effective solutions for data visualization.Another significant trend is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) into data visualization tools. AI and ML capabilities enhance the ability of these tools to automatically identify patterns and insights from complex datasets, providing users with deeper, more accurate analyses. This is particularly useful for large enterprises handling vast amounts of data across multiple business functions. Additionally, cloud-based deployment options continue to gain popularity as they offer flexibility, scalability, and cost-effectiveness. The shift towards cloud computing enables businesses to access powerful data visualization tools without the need for expensive hardware or extensive IT infrastructure.

What is a standalone data visualization tool?
A standalone data visualization tool is a software solution that allows users to create visual representations of data without requiring integration with other software systems.
Why are standalone data visualization tools important?
Standalone data visualization tools help organizations transform complex data into easily understandable visual formats, facilitating better decision-making and insights.
How do standalone data visualization tools benefit small businesses?
These tools offer small businesses an affordable way to visualize data, helping them make data-driven decisions and improve operational efficiency.
Can large enterprises benefit from standalone data visualization tools?
Yes, large enterprises can benefit from standalone data visualization tools by enabling centralized, real-time data analysis that supports strategic decision-making.
What industries use standalone data visualization tools?
Industries like healthcare, finance, retail, manufacturing, and education commonly use data visualization tools to make sense of large datasets and improve decision-making.
Are standalone data visualization tools compatible with cloud-based systems?
Many standalone data visualization tools are cloud-based or offer cloud integration, making them highly compatible with modern cloud computing systems.
What is the difference between standalone and integrated data visualization tools?
Standalone tools operate independently, while integrated tools are part of a larger suite of analytics or business intelligence platforms.
How much do standalone data visualization tools cost?
The cost varies depending on the vendor, features, and deployment model, but many tools offer subscription-based pricing or pay-per-user models.
What are the most popular standalone data visualization tools?
Popular tools include Tableau, Microsoft Power BI, QlikView, and Sisense, which are widely used for creating data dashboards and visual reports.
What trends are driving the standalone data visualization tools market?
Key trends include the increasing use of AI and machine learning, the demand for user-friendly interfaces, and the shift towards cloud-based platforms.
